Honey Chili-Lime Sauce

A sweet-and-spicy sauce of honey, crushed New Mexico red chiles, lime and cilantro.

Ingredients

  • 1 red bell pepper, cut into 1/2-inch pieces
  • 1/2 cup caribe (crushed New Mexico red chiles)
  • 1 cup honey
  • 1/2 cup fresh lime juice
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h cilantro

Instructions

  1. Simmer bell pepper, caribe, honey, lime juice, and salt in a 1-quart heavy saucepan over moderate heat, stirring occasionally, until sauce is slightly thickened, about 30 minutes.
  2. Cool sauce to warm or room temperature, then stir in cilantro just before serving. Serve over meat dish or on the side.

Notes

Sauce (without cilantro) may be made 2 days ahead and chilled, covered. Heat over low heat until warm and stir in cilantro.
